Alabama's Fake Mustache Law: This is a commonly cited quirky law. It's often claimed that in Alabama, it's illegal to wear a fake mustache in church that causes laughter. While it's a popular story, there's no clear evidence this law is currently in effect or enforced.

Arizona's Law on Donkeys in Bathtubs: This one is a classic example often mentioned in lists of strange laws. The story goes that it's illegal in Arizona for donkeys to sleep in bathtubs. It's cited as originating from an incident where a donkey sleeping in a bathtub was swept away by a flood. Whether this is an enforceable law today is doubtful.

Wisconsin's Apple Pie Without Cheese Law: It's often humorously stated that in Wisconsin, serving apple pie in public restaurants without cheese is illegal. This law is more folklore than fact, and while Wisconsin is known for its cheese, this "law" is likely more of a humorous anecdote than an actual statute.
